Output 28a43dabbb1661484813229963e0c629f0f6e7a09dec0576cd7b733f6a22aede:77

value
3188646
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 53a8c3b6cc381063a955a5df22de385a58f52fba95a1d32c636cc5e3cab01038
address
bc1p2w5v8dkv8qgx82245h0j9h3ctfv02ta6jksaxtrrdnz78j4szquqxdzev8
transaction
28a43dabbb1661484813229963e0c629f0f6e7a09dec0576cd7b733f6a22aede
confirmations
2137
spent
true